Remember seeing The Nutcracker ballet when you were a child? The Sugar Plum Fairy and her graceful candy attendants, elegant ladies in jewel-toned ball gowns and their handsome companions, the toy soldiers ready for battle, and, of course, the brave little girl who saved her beloved Nutcracker from the seven-headed Mouse King?
With a pure storyteller’s voice and the stunning illustrations for which she is renowned, New York Times bestselling artist Susan Jeffers transports us all, especially the littlest reader, into an enchanted world. This is the perfect gift to share with children before they see The Nutcracker, but anyone who has seen this ballet will cherish this magical story where love saves the day. (Ages 4-6)
